TPBI Public Company Limited (TPBI) has received the Future Trends Awards 2026 under The Better World Corporate Awards in the Leading of Environmental Product category. Ms. Chamaiporn Uerpairojkit, Chief Executive Officer, represented the company in receiving the award at the Future Trends Awards 2026 ceremony, held on 26 February 2026 at Bhiraj Hall, BITEC Bangna. The recognition reflects TPBI's continued strength in developing packaging products and solutions with environmental considerations at the core.
The Leading of Environmental Product award is one of the honors under The Better World Corporate Awards, which recognizes organizations with outstanding ESG leadership and a proven ability to create positive value for society and the environment. This aligns with TPBI's direction in continuously developing packaging solutions that respond to global trends and evolving market demands, while consistently raising operational standards under its commitment to creating shared value for society, the environment, and a sustainable future.
Over the years, TPBI has focused on developing a wide range of packaging solutions, including packaging containing PCR (Post-consumer Recycled) plastic resin, packaging designed to biodegrade in the environment, and mono-material packaging, which helps improve the recyclability of pouch packaging. In addition, the company has developed various PCR resin formulations with different PCR content ratios to support the production of a broad range of products tailored to customer needs.
This achievement marks another important milestone for TPBI and reaffirms the company's business direction in developing packaging products that deliver on quality, innovation, and environmental responsibility, while supporting sustainable growth for the business and all stakeholders.
